Is Beef Rump High in Fat? A Nutritional Breakdown

Nutritional data reveals that a raw, lean beef rump steak can contain as little as 2.8 grams of fat per 100g serving. This fact challenges the common perception of beef, proving that beef rump can be a surprisingly lean choice, though its fat content varies significantly based on the cut and preparation method.

Which is Leaner, Sirloin or Rump Steak?

Rump steak is generally considered leaner than sirloin due to its location on the cow and the associated muscle usage. While both are popular beef cuts, the hard-working muscles in the hindquarter where rump is sourced result in less marbling compared to the sirloin. Understanding the distinction is crucial for those prioritizing a lower fat intake in their diet.

How many calories and protein are in a rump steak?

An average cooked, lean rump steak contains approximately 180 calories and 20 grams of protein per 100g serving, making it a nutrient-dense choice for a balanced diet. This moderate-calorie red meat option offers an excellent protein-to-calorie ratio, providing satiety without an excessive energy load.

How many calories are in raw beef rump steak?

A lean, raw beef rump steak contains approximately 122-125 calories per 100g, making it a relatively low-calorie protein source. Understanding how many calories are in raw beef rump steak is key for accurate nutritional tracking, especially for meal prepping or specific diet plans.

How many grams of protein are in 500 grams of rump steak?

According to nutrition databases, rump steak typically contains around 20-24 grams of protein per 100 grams, meaning 500 grams of rump steak can provide an impressive 100 to 120 grams of high-quality protein. This makes it an excellent choice for anyone looking to increase their protein intake, from athletes to individuals following a specific diet plan.
